KITCHEN UTILITY WORKER
Reports To: Executive Chef
Department: Kitchen
Status Type: Part-Time, Hourly
Salary: $15.00
Schedule: Day and evening shifts available. Preference will be given to applicants with flexible availability
POSITION OVERVIEW:
The Kitchen Utility Worker plays a vital role in ensuring the cleanliness, organization, and smooth operation of the kitchen at Mission Hills Country Club. This position supports the culinary team by maintaining a clean and sanitary work environment, assisting with dishwashing, and handling food preparation support tasks as needed.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:
Dishwashing & Cleaning:
- Wash and sanitize dishes, utensils, pots, and pans following health and safety guidelines.
- Maintain cleanliness of kitchen equipment, floors, walls, and storage areas.
- Remove trash and recyclables regularly and ensure proper disposal procedures.
Food Preparation Support:
- Assist in receiving, stocking, and organizing food and kitchen supplies.
- Support food preparation tasks as directed by chefs, including peeling, chopping, and portioning ingredients.
Safety & Compliance:
- Ensure compliance with all safety and sanitation regulations, including proper handling of chemicals and cleaning supplies.
- Keep dishwashing area and other kitchen stations neat and organized.
Team Collaboration:
- Work collaboratively with chefs, line cooks, and service staff to ensure efficient kitchen operations.

EDUCATION & QUALIFICATIONS:
Education and Experience
- Previous experience in a kitchen, restaurant, or hospitality setting preferred but not required.
COMPETENCIES:
- Strong organizational and time-management skills.
- Ability to work well in a fast-paced environment while maintaining attention to detail.
- Ability to stand for long periods and lift up to 50 lbs.
- Knowledge of proper sanitation and safety procedures is a plus.
- Ability to work evenings, weekends and holidays based on event schedule.
